Section 2011 definition

Section 2011 means section 2011 of the Internal Revenue Code as it existed on December 31, 2000."]
Section 2011 means "Section 2011," Internal Revenue Code.
Section 2011 means section 2011 of the [federal] Internal Revenue Code [of 1986, as amended or renumbered.] as it existed on December 31, 2000.
